The Goonies (1985)
Adventure, Comedy, Family • 1h 54m
Overview
Young teen Mikey Walsh and his friends set off on a quest to find Pirate One-Eyed Willie's treasure in hopes of saving their homes from demolition. However, on their quest to find the treasure, they run into a family of recently escaped criminals, determined to capture the kids and reach the treasure first.
Director: Richard Donner

Director: Stanley Kubrick
US Cut: WB 4K Blu-ray
International Cut: Old 2007 Europe Blu-ray
Criterion Box Set
US Cut: WB 4K Blu-ray
International Cut: Old 2007 Europe Blu-ray
No Blu-ray or DVD release has presented the movie in its original theatrical aspect ratio of 1.85:1 for the US cut or 1.66:1 for the International cut.
The packaging on the back of the 4K Blu-ray incorrectly states it as 1.85:1 when the movie is actually 1.78:1 as is the original Blu-ray.

Director: Ridley Scott
Final Cut: WB 4K Blu-ray (Caveat: No Dolby Vision from Streaming)
Workprint: WB 30th Anniversary Blu-ray Set for a better AVC encode
Final Cut: WB 4K Blu-ray (Caveat: No Dolby Vision from Streaming)
Workprint: WB 30th Anniversary Blu-ray Set for a better AVC encode
1982 Theatrical Mix: Embassy Video releases, HD-DVD for the 70mm 6-track mix
International Cut Dolby Stereo: Criterion Collection LaserDisc, HD-DVD for the 70mm 6-track mix
1992 Director's Cut Dolby Stereo: WB CAV LaserDisc 2.0 PCM-best fidelity of any mix, HD-DVD for the 70mm 6-track mix
Workprint: WB 30th Anniversary Blu-ray Set DTS-HD MA 5.1
2007 Final Cut remix: Blu-ray Dolby TrueHD 5.1
WB 4K Blu-ray only has Final Cut and contains a bad Atmos remix with new sound effects. Original Final Cut mix was removed.
